Tamaki Hiroshi stars in TV Asahi drama SP "Jiken Kyuumeii ~ IMAT no Kiseki ~"

Tamaki Hiroshi takes on the lead role in TV Asahi's new drama SP "Jiken Kyuumeii ~ IMAT no Kiseki" which will be shown in September this year. The story is based on the Incident Medical Assistance Team (IMAT for short) which is a medical despatch unit consisting of doctors from Nippon Medical School Hospital formed last September at the request of the Metropolitan Police Department to handle emergency cases where medical treatment is needed. As the IMAT members have to wear the full set of uniform and accessories including gloves, helmets and bulletproof vests at the crime scene while rendering medical assistance, Tamaki remarked that it was very tough to do that during the filming process due to the hot weather. This is the first drama based on IMAT and the first doctor role for Tamaki. As the entire filming has to be done on location, the process lasted a full month which is twice as long than usual for a drama SP.

Co-stars include Tanaka Kei, Takahashi Katsunori, Kanjiya Shihori and Mizuno Miki.
